    The Grumman TBF Avenger was a torpedo bomber developed initially for the United States Navy and Marine Corps, and eventually used by several air or naval arms around the world. It entered U.S. service in 1942, and first saw action during the Battle of Midway.

    Launching torpedoes from the air was the special task of this Avenger aircraft here seen taking off from the flight deck of a U.S aircraft carrier operating against the Japanese in the Pacific. Powered by a 1700 hp. Wright Cyclone engine, and armed with .50 and .30 calibre machine-guns and one 22-in. torpedo, the Avenger had a speed of 270 miles an hour. In May 1944 it was announced that the U.S. Navy alone would soon have a force of 37,700 planes.
